Fifty-five artisans, one September weekend

The Chatham Fall Craft Festival takes over the downtown lawn of the Chatham Community Center on Saturday, September 7 and Sunday, September 8, 2024. Fifty-five select artisans display American-made works: fine art photography, original paintings, resin craft, fine jewelry, nautical art, metal craft, tile mosaics, quilts, shell craft, cork leather bags, turned wood, glass art, and more. Between the tents, sample kettle corn, jams, jellies, cookies, baked goods, and specialty foods.
